Autumn decides whether a colony survives the winter, and it does so through one plant more than any other. Ivy in October is worth more to a northern European colony than most of what flowers in June.

September and October forage is worth disproportionately more than anything else you can plant, because it determines what survives the winter.
The colony raises a physiologically different kind of worker in late autumn. Winter bees carry elevated levels of vitellogenin, a storage protein that lets them live for four to six months rather than six weeks, and they are reared on the last good pollen of the year — which is why autumn pollen matters so much more than autumn nectar. The colony also expels the drones, which have no function once mating season is over, and contracts into a cluster. Ivy provides both nectar and pollen in quantity from September to November and is the single most important autumn plant in Britain and northern Europe.
The colony dies. Workers, males and the old queen all die with the first hard frosts, and only the new queens — mated in late summer — survive, each finding a hole in the ground to hibernate alone until spring. That means an autumn bumblebee is almost always a new queen feeding up for hibernation, and what she finds in September and October determines whether she has the fat reserves to survive six months underground. Ivy again does most of the work.
Nearly all are already dead. The generation now underground or in stems is a set of provisioned cells containing larvae or pre-pupae that will not emerge until spring. That has one very practical consequence: an autumn tidy-up that cuts and burns hollow stems, clears leaf litter or turns over bare soil destroys next year's bees, invisibly, and nothing about the garden looks any different.
Leave the ivy alone and let it flower. Do not cut hollow stems until spring. Leave leaf litter. Autumn is the season where doing less is the whole of the advice, and where the most damage is done with a tidy conscience.

Months here are northern-hemisphere temperate. Southern-hemisphere readers should shift by roughly six months — but that shift is an approximation rather than a translation, because day length, rainfall pattern and the local flora do not shift with it. Records that genuinely span both hemispheres say so.
